Maintaining strong bones is crucial as we age. Fortunately, there are several effective exercises you can incorporate into your routine to improve bone density and reduce the risk of osteoporosis. Weight-bearing exercises, like walking, put stress on your bones, stimulating them to become stronger. Strength training exercises using weights or resistance bands also help build physical strength, which supports bone health. Additionally, engaging in regular activities such as dancing, climbing stairs, and playing sports can contribute to a robust skeletal system.
- Participate in at least 30 minutes of weight-bearing exercise most days of the week.
- Include resistance training exercises that work all major muscle groups twice a week.
- Talk to your doctor before starting any new exercise program, especially if you have pre-existing health conditions.
Nourish Your Bones
Maintaining healthy bones as you age is crucial for overall well-being. Your bones are constantly remodeling, degrading old bone tissue and creating new. To ensure your skeletal system remains strong, it's essential to incorporate foods rich in bone-strengthening nutrients.
- Cheese are classic sources of calcium, helping enhance bone density.
- Spinach, kale, and collard greens are packed with vitamin K, which promote calcium absorption.
- Almonds provide a good amount of this mineral, which plays a role in the process of bone formation.
Incorporating these nutrient-rich foods into your diet can help maintain your bone health and reduce the risk of osteoporosis. Keep in mind that a healthy lifestyle also includes regular exercise, which is crucial to strong bones.
